CVE-2019-0031
Specific IPv6 DHCP packets received by the jdhcpd daemon will cause a memory resource consumption issue to occur on a Junos OS device using the jdhcpd daemon configured to respond to IPv6 requests. Once started, memory consumption will eventually impact any IPv4 or IPv6 request serviced by the...
CVE-2019-0028
On Junos devices with the BGP graceful restart helper mode enabled or the BGP graceful restart mechanism enabled, a BGP session restart on a remote peer that has the graceful restart mechanism enabled may cause the local routing protocol daemon RPD process to crash and restart. By simulating a...
CVE-2019-0039
If REST API is enabled, the Junos OS login credentials are vulnerable to brute force attacks. The high default connection limit of the REST API may allow an attacker to brute-force passwords using advanced scripting techniques. Additionally, administrators who do not enforce a strong password...

CVE-2019-0036
When configuring a stateless firewall filter in Junos OS, terms named using the format "internal-n" e.g. "internal-1", "internal-2", etc. are silently ignored. No warning is issued during configuration, and the config is committed without error, but the filter criteria will match all packets...

CVE-2019-0009
On EX2300 and EX3400 series, high disk I/O operations may disrupt the communication between the routing engine RE and the packet forwarding engine PFE. In a virtual chassis VC deployment, this issue disrupts communication between the VC members. This issue does not affect other Junos platforms...
CVE-2019-0007
The vMX Series software uses a predictable IP ID Sequence Number. This leaves the system as well as clients connecting through the device susceptible to a family of attacks which rely on the use of predictable IP ID sequence numbers as their base method of attack. This issue was found during...
